EXCEL怎么合并Excel

EXCEL怎么合并Excel

EXCEL怎么合并Excel? 使用合并功能、Power Query、VBA脚本、手动复制粘贴、第三方软件。在这些方法中,Power Query是特别有用且高效的方法。Power Query是一种强大的数据连接和转换工具,可以帮助你从多个Excel文件中提取数据并将其合并到一个文件中。通过Power Query,你可以自动化这个过程,并减少出错的机会。

Power Query:Power Query是Excel中的一个强大工具,尤其适用于需要从多个文件中提取、转换和加载数据的场景。利用Power Query,你可以轻松地将多个Excel文件中的数据合并到一个表中,而不需要手动复制和粘贴。它的优势在于,当源文件的数据发生变化时,你只需要刷新查询,数据就会自动更新。使用Power Query合并Excel文件的具体步骤如下:

  1. 打开Excel并创建一个新工作簿。
  2. 选择“数据”选项卡,然后选择“获取数据”。
  3. 选择“从文件” -> “从文件夹”。
  4. 浏览到包含要合并的Excel文件的文件夹,然后点击“确定”。
  5. 选择“合并”和“加载”选项,以将所有文件中的数据合并到一个表中。

一、使用合并功能

Excel内置的合并功能是最常见的方法之一。该功能允许你合并来自不同工作表或工作簿的相同类型的数据。

步骤

  1. 打开所有相关的Excel工作簿:确保所有需要合并的文件都已经打开。
  2. 选择目标单元格:在目标工作簿中选择一个空白的工作表或特定单元格,作为合并数据的起始点。
  3. 使用合并功能:在“数据”选项卡下,选择“合并”按钮。你可以选择不同的函数(如求和、平均值等)来合并数据。

合并功能的优点是操作简单、直观,适合处理相对简单的数据合并任务。但如果数据量较大或数据结构复杂,可能需要借助更高级的方法。

二、使用Power Query

Power Query是Excel中的一项强大功能,尤其适用于需要从多个文件中提取、转换和加载数据的场景。利用Power Query,你可以轻松地将多个Excel文件中的数据合并到一个表中,而不需要手动复制和粘贴。

步骤

  1. 打开Excel并创建一个新工作簿:这是你的目标工作簿。
  2. 选择“数据”选项卡:在Excel的顶部菜单栏中。
  3. 选择“获取数据”:选择“从文件” -> “从文件夹”。
  4. 浏览到包含要合并的Excel文件的文件夹:然后点击“确定”。
  5. 选择“合并”和“加载”选项:以将所有文件中的数据合并到一个表中。

Power Query的优势在于,当源文件的数据发生变化时,你只需要刷新查询,数据就会自动更新。它非常适合处理复杂的数据合并任务。

三、使用VBA脚本

对于更复杂的需求,使用VBA脚本是一个很好的选择。VBA(Visual Basic for Applications)是一种编程语言,可以帮助你自动化Excel中的各种任务。

步骤

  1. 打开Excel并按Alt + F11:进入VBA编辑器。
  2. 插入一个新模块:在VBA编辑器中,选择“插入” -> “模块”。
  3. 编写VBA代码:在新模块中粘贴或编写你的VBA代码。以下是一个简单的示例代码,用于将多个工作簿中的数据合并到一个工作簿中:

Sub 合并工作簿()

Dim 文件路径 As String, 文件名 As String

Dim wb As Workbook, ws As Worksheet

Dim 主工作簿 As Workbook, 目标工作表 As Worksheet

Set 主工作簿 = ThisWorkbook

Set 目标工作表 = 主工作簿.Sheets(1)

文件路径 = "C:你的文件夹路径"

文件名 = Dir(文件路径 & "*.xls*")

Do While 文件名 <> ""

Set wb = Workbooks.Open(文件路径 & 文件名)

For Each ws In wb.Sheets

ws.UsedRange.Copy 目标工作表.Cells(目标工作表.Rows.Count, 1).End(xlUp).Offset(1, 0)

Next ws

wb.Close False

文件名 = Dir

Loop

End Sub

  1. 运行脚本:按F5键运行脚本。

使用VBA脚本的优势在于它的高灵活性和自动化能力,适合处理非常复杂的数据合并任务。

四、手动复制粘贴

手动复制粘贴是最直接的方法,适合处理少量数据或需要快速完成的简单任务。

步骤

  1. 打开所有相关的Excel工作簿:确保所有需要合并的文件都已经打开。
  2. 选择源数据:在源工作簿中选择要复制的数据。
  3. 复制数据:按Ctrl + C键复制选择的数据。
  4. 粘贴数据:在目标工作簿中选择一个空白的工作表或特定单元格,然后按Ctrl + V键粘贴数据。

虽然手动复制粘贴的方法非常简单,但它不适合处理大量数据或频繁更新的数据合并任务。

五、使用第三方软件

有很多第三方软件可以帮助你合并Excel文件,这些软件通常提供更多的功能和更高的效率。

步骤

  1. 下载并安装第三方软件:如“Excel Merger”或“Merge Excel Files”。
  2. 选择要合并的文件:在软件界面中选择要合并的Excel文件。
  3. 选择合并选项:根据需要选择合并选项,如合并到一个工作表或多个工作表。
  4. 执行合并操作:点击合并按钮,软件会自动完成数据合并。

第三方软件的优势在于它们通常提供更多的功能,如批量处理、高级筛选和数据清理等,非常适合处理复杂的合并任务。

六、合并后的数据管理

合并数据只是第一步,合并后的数据管理同样重要。你需要确保合并后的数据是准确的、无冗余的,并且易于管理和分析。

数据清理:在合并数据后,使用Excel的“数据清理”功能来删除重复项、空白单元格和其他不必要的数据。

数据验证:使用Excel的“数据验证”功能来确保合并后的数据符合预期。例如,你可以设置数据验证规则来确保所有数值在一个合理的范围内。

数据分析:使用Excel的“数据透视表”和“图表”功能来分析合并后的数据。数据透视表可以帮助你快速总结和分析数据,而图表可以帮助你更直观地理解数据。

七、Power Query的高级功能

除了基本的合并功能,Power Query还有许多高级功能,可以进一步增强你的数据处理能力。

数据转换:Power Query提供了丰富的数据转换功能,如拆分列、合并列、替换值和删除空白行等。这些功能可以帮助你在合并数据前进行数据清理和预处理。

数据连接:Power Query支持多种数据源连接,包括数据库、Web数据源、文本文件等。你可以将来自不同数据源的数据连接并合并到一个Excel表中。

自动刷新:Power Query的自动刷新功能可以帮助你保持数据的最新状态。当源文件的数据发生变化时,只需要刷新查询,数据就会自动更新。

八、VBA脚本的高级应用

VBA脚本除了可以合并Excel文件外,还可以实现更多的自动化任务。

定时任务:你可以使用VBA脚本设置定时任务,自动定期合并数据。例如,你可以设置每天早上自动合并前一天的数据。

数据处理:VBA脚本可以实现复杂的数据处理任务,如数据过滤、排序和分组等。这些功能可以帮助你在合并数据后进行进一步的处理和分析。

界面交互:你可以使用VBA脚本创建用户界面,使数据合并过程更加友好和易用。例如,你可以创建一个对话框,让用户选择要合并的文件和合并选项。

九、手动复制粘贴的技巧

虽然手动复制粘贴方法简单,但也有一些技巧可以提高效率和准确性。

使用快捷键:掌握一些常用的快捷键可以大大提高你的工作效率。例如,Ctrl + C复制、Ctrl + V粘贴、Ctrl + A全选等。

分批复制粘贴:如果数据量较大,可以分批复制粘贴,以避免Excel崩溃或响应速度变慢。

使用模板:创建一个合并数据的模板,可以帮助你快速进行数据合并。例如,你可以创建一个模板,包含所有需要合并的数据的表头和格式。

十、第三方软件的选择

选择合适的第三方软件可以大大提高你的数据合并效率和准确性。

功能丰富性:选择功能丰富的软件,可以满足你不同的合并需求。例如,一些软件支持批量处理、高级筛选和数据清理等功能。

用户界面友好性:用户界面友好的软件可以让你更轻松地进行数据合并。例如,一些软件提供了向导式的操作流程,可以帮助你一步步完成数据合并。

技术支持:选择有良好技术支持的软件,可以帮助你解决使用过程中遇到的问题。例如,一些软件提供了详细的用户手册、在线帮助和技术支持服务。

十一、合并数据的最佳实践

无论你使用哪种方法进行数据合并,都有一些最佳实践可以帮助你提高效率和准确性。

备份数据:在进行数据合并前,务必备份所有原始数据,以防止数据丢失或损坏。

验证数据:在合并数据后,务必进行数据验证,确保合并后的数据是准确的、无冗余的。

记录过程:记录数据合并的过程和步骤,可以帮助你在遇到问题时快速定位和解决问题。例如,你可以创建一个文档,记录每个步骤的操作和结果。

十二、实际案例分析

通过实际案例分析,可以更好地理解和应用上述方法和技巧。

案例一:销售数据合并:某公司有多个销售部门,每个部门都有一个独立的Excel文件记录销售数据。通过使用Power Query,可以轻松地将所有部门的销售数据合并到一个Excel文件中,并进行统一分析。

案例二:财务数据合并:某公司有多个子公司,每个子公司都有一个独立的Excel文件记录财务数据。通过使用VBA脚本,可以自动定期合并所有子公司的财务数据,并生成财务报表。

案例三:市场调研数据合并:某公司进行了一次市场调研,收集了多个Excel文件的调研数据。通过手动复制粘贴和数据清理,可以将所有调研数据合并到一个Excel文件中,并进行数据分析。

十三、未来趋势

随着数据量的不断增加和数据分析需求的不断提升,Excel数据合并的方法和工具也在不断发展。

云计算:未来,越来越多的Excel数据合并将借助云计算技术,实现更高效的数据处理和存储。例如,微软的Power BI和Google的BigQuery都提供了强大的数据合并和分析功能。

人工智能:人工智能技术将进一步提升数据合并的智能化和自动化水平。例如,机器学习算法可以帮助自动识别和处理数据中的异常值和缺失值。

大数据技术:大数据技术将进一步提升数据合并的规模和速度。例如,Hadoop和Spark等大数据平台可以处理海量数据,并实现快速的数据合并和分析。

十四、总结

合并Excel文件是一个常见的任务,但它的复杂性和难度取决于数据的量和结构。通过使用合并功能、Power Query、VBA脚本、手动复制粘贴和第三方软件,你可以根据具体需求选择最合适的方法。每种方法都有其优点和适用场景,了解并掌握这些方法,可以帮助你更高效地完成数据合并任务。同时,数据合并后的管理和处理同样重要,确保数据的准确性和易用性,可以为后续的数据分析和决策提供有力支持。

相关问答FAQs:

1. 如何在Excel中合并单元格?

在Excel中,要合并单元格,可以按照以下步骤操作:

  • 选中要合并的单元格,可以是连续的单元格,也可以是不连续的单元格。
  • 在主菜单中选择"开始"选项卡,然后点击"合并和居中"按钮。或者,你也可以使用快捷键Ctrl + Shift + J来合并选中的单元格。
  • 单元格将会合并为一个单元格,原始数据只会保留在合并区域的左上角单元格中。

2. 如何在Excel中合并多个工作簿?

要在Excel中合并多个工作簿,可以按照以下步骤进行操作:

  • 打开要合并的第一个工作簿。
  • 在主菜单中选择"开始"选项卡,然后点击"合并工作簿"按钮。
  • 在弹出的对话框中,选择要合并的其他工作簿文件,并点击"添加"按钮。
  • 确定要合并的工作簿文件后,点击"合并"按钮。
  • Excel将会创建一个新的工作簿,并将选中的工作簿合并到其中。

3. 如何在Excel中合并单元格中的数据?

如果你想合并单元格中的数据而不是单元格本身,可以按照以下步骤进行操作:

  • 选中要合并的单元格,可以是连续的单元格,也可以是不连续的单元格。
  • 在主菜单中选择"开始"选项卡,然后点击"合并和居中"按钮。
  • 在弹出的对话框中,选择"合并后保留值"选项,然后点击"确定"按钮。
  • 单元格将会合并为一个单元格,并且原始数据也会合并到新的单元格中。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4768482

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部